The purpose of the Company is to provide a comprehensive range of banking services to both corporate and private clients, including residents and non-residents of the Autonomous Island of Anjouan. These services encompass accepting deposits, offering loans, conducting currency exchange, issuing securities, processing credit cards, managing securities, acting as an intermediary in trading, providing guarantees, facilitating payments, and holding assets on behalf of third parties. This License is subject to modifications as stipulated in “Government Notice No. 004 of 2005” and “Government Notice No. 5 of 2005.”


The License shall be automatically and without notice revoked under the following circumstances:

  1. If the Company engages in activities prohibited by or in violation of any laws, regulations, or standards in force in the Autonomous Island of Anjouan, Union of Comoros.
  2. If the Company, being an international entity, operates beyond its approved constitution in a manner not permitted under Anjouan’s legal framework.
  3. If the Company operates in sectors such as insurance, air/sea transport, gambling, or other licensed businesses without obtaining the necessary specific licenses.
  4. If the Company fails to maintain at least one Director or one member, or invites the public to subscribe to shares or debentures.

The Company is not considered to be conducting business in Anjouan if it:

  • Engages with other companies incorporated under the Act.
  • Leases premises for its business as permitted by the Act.
  • Maintains deposits or professional services with entities licensed to conduct banking business in Anjouan.
  • Prepares its books, holds meetings, or maintains records within the jurisdiction.

Failure to make timely renewal payments will result in the suspension or revocation of the License and International Business Company (IBC). Furthermore, the persons responsible for managing the Company’s business shall be held personally, jointly, and severally liable for any actions, irregularities, or violations committed after cancellation. They must also provide annual police clearance certificates confirming their absence from criminal proceedings.

Any changes to the Company, including share capital adjustments or the appointment or removal of Directors or Shareholders, must be approved by the Anjouan Registrar of International Business Companies.

By accepting this License, the Company acknowledges and agrees to adhere to all terms and conditions, which may be amended at any time by the Registrar of International Business Companies.
